COMMITTEE Miss B Aves, Mrs B Millen, Mr C Burton, Mr K Mitchell, Mrs P Pearman, Mrs A Pusey HistoryThe BGS is one of the oldest Horticultural Societies in England. It used to hold its Summer Flower Show on Bull Green, now the home of the Bethersden Cricket Club. This was a huge annual event in the village when there would be fancy dress competitions, athletics races for the children (with some competitions for the adults thrown in), sideshows like coconut shies, catch the rat and many more. Shows are now held in the Village Hall and attract many competitors and visitors alike. It is a thriving Society and enjoys a visit to an RHS garden annually, plus hosting interesting speakers at the AGM.
